@Khisanth.2948 said:What exactly is wrong with a mobile game set in the GW universe?Well, for one it would require shifting resources away from GW2. As a gw2 player that would worry me.Especially since mobile market is more lucrative (for now anyway, if the current EU trend about lootboxes and microtransactions goes further, that migh eventually stop being the case), but is also aimed at a different type of players.

Mobiles are aimed at high player retention. Instead of worrying about longterm player loyalty, they prefer to rip their players as much as possible shortterm. If they leave, let them, the new victims will replace them soon. And if the game dies? Make a new one - development costs of mobile games are much, much lower than of AAA MMORPGs.

I'd rather Anet was not enticed into this mentality. They are already too close to it for my taste in their gemshop practices.
